
BusyBoxは、Linuxシステムの初期起動やリモート管理に欠かせないツール群を単一の実行可能ファイルとして纏めたものである。1999年にJoey Hessによって作られ、その後、多くの開発者が加わり改良されてきた。
目次
この記事の目次
- BusyBoxの機能と特徴
- BusyBoxの発展史
- BusyBoxと他のシステムツールの比較
- BusyBoxの内部構造
- まとめ
BusyBoxの機能と特徴

BusyBoxは、Linux環境での初期起動やリモート管理の効率化のために作られた。
たとえば、ネットワーク接続が不可能な状況下でも、スクリプトを実行してシステム情報の収集を行うことが可能である。
BusyBoxの発展史

BusyBoxは、1999年に最初のバージョンがリリースされた。
その後、様々なLinuxディストリビューションやIoTデバイスに組み込まれるなど、広範囲にわたって利用されるようになった。
BusyBoxと他のシステムツールの比較

BusyBoxは他のシステムツールとは異なり、多くのコマンドを統合し、小型化とシンプルな設計を目指す。
これにより、リソース制約のある環境でも効率的な利用が可能となる。
BusyBoxの内部構造

BusyBoxは、モジュール化された設計により高い柔軟性を提供する。
これを利用することで、特定の環境に合わせて独自のスクリプトを作成したり、機能を選択的に有効にすることができる。
まとめ
BusyBoxは、Linuxシステムでの初期起動やリモート管理における重要な役割を果たすだけでなく、デバイスのリソース効率性と柔軟性も向上させるツールである。
※本記事はIT用語辞典の手書きドラフトです。公開前に最新情報・出典を確認のうえ加筆修正してください。

コメント